Working at a company like Mallon And Taub Opticians (Marylebone)
Mallon And Taub Opticians in Marylebone is an independent practice, offering a more personal approach to eye care. This independence fosters a dedicated and community-focused working atmosphere where professionals can truly connect with their patients and colleagues.
- Location: Situated at 63 Paddington Street, W1U 4JF, the practice benefits from its central London position. The Marylebone neighbourhood offers excellent transport links and local amenities, making daily commuting straightforward.
- Roles available: Opportunities may arise for optometrists, practice managers, assistant managers, dispensing opticians, and optical assistants.
